擅长:python、mysql、java
<p>请注意,由于2.4 ijson有一个新的<code>yajl2_c</code>后端,全部用C编写(即不使用cffi或ctypes),它比其他后端快约10倍。由于2.5,这是默认情况下选择的,如果在您的安装中出现(可能是您的情况,因此您看到了更快的执行)。从2.6开始,有一个新的<code>kvitems</code>方法可以避免构造完整的对象并迭代其成员,这在某些情况下很有用</p>
<p>历史上没有<code>yajl2_c</code>后端,所以当人们提到“C后端”时,实际上是<code>yajl2_cffi</code>后端。除此之外,人们可能仍然认为ijson默认使用<code>python</code>后端</p>
<p>所以要回答您的问题:您可能正在使用<code>yajl2_c</code>后端运行ijson,并且运行速度比JsonSlicer快</p>